Rubio: Durham Report Details Serious And Unforgivable Breaches

May 15, 2023 | Press Releases

After a four-year investigation, special counsel John Durham denounced the FBI’s investigation into whether the Trump campaign coordinated with Russia to influence the 2016 presidential election. The report finds the FBI “failed to uphold their mission of strict fidelity to the law” because it did not have sufficient evidence to launch an investigation.
 
U.S. Senator Marco Rubio, vice chairman of the Senate Select Committee on Intelligence, condemned the FBI’s investigation and warned it undermined America’s national security.

  • “The Durham Report details serious and unforgivable breaches by federal law enforcement. Relying on altered documents and partisan opposition research is an extreme abuse of power. There is no justification for using national security tools designed to keep America safe for partisan political gain. Those responsible need to be held accountable, not just for meddling in the presidential election but also for the damage done to our institutions. America and its institutions are weaker today because of their actions, and it will take years for the FBI and others to rebuild that trust. Rigorous oversight of the FBI’s intelligence activities must be a top priority for the congressional intelligence committees.” – Senator Rubio

Flashback … In August 2018, the Senate intelligence committee released the fifth and final volume of its bipartisan Russia report. “We can say, without any hesitation, that the Committee found absolutely no evidence that then-candidate Donald Trump or his campaign colluded with the Russian government to meddle in the 2016 election,” Rubio said at the time.
